How to update ev3snapshot/sdcard/

Postby WizGeek » Thu Aug 31, 2017 9:31 pm

How does one update in the ./ev3snapshot/sdcard/ folder?

It appears the Ant build for ev3snapshot builds all subprojects and updates all other folders in ev3snapshot except the sdcard/ files. Granted, the file likely is quite static and doesn't need updating when leJOS jar files are built, but the contains the latest jars, yes?
Postby gloomyandy » Fri Sep 01, 2017 8:05 am

There are two repos for the EV3 release. The first contains all of the higher level stuff and the snapshot and can be built reasonably easily using eclipse. The second contains all of th low level stuff like the Linux kernel, the file system, driver modules,native code modules etc. It is much more complex to build and needs a Linux system. Unless you really, really need to do it I would avoid building this part of leJOS. If all you need to do is update some of the jars it is much easier to build the snapshot and then copy the required jars over the top of the ones of an already installed EV3 system. If you feel you must recreate then you will need a Linux system, if you don't need to rebuild any of the native code then you can get away with just running, if you do need to build any of the native components you will need to install the codesourcery cross compiler and possibly other tools and will probably need a pretty good knowledge of relatively low level Linux development.
